Like quite a few of the key cannabinoids in cannabis, THCA starts its daily life as CBGA. Like a cannabis plant matures, an enzymatic method requires location within its trichomes that induce a considerable part of the CBGA to turn into THCA, CBDA, and CBCA. These are the acidic variations of the higher-recognized cannabinoids THC, CBD, and CBC.
The distinction between cannabis and hemp is how much THC they include. Hemp is outlined as obtaining fewer than 0.3% of THC whilst marijuana includes far more. Hemp doesn’t have more than enough THC to cause a high, nevertheless it does have THC.
